§ 23-63-2. Disposal of used vehicle rubber tires — Burning prohibited — Storage restricted.

(a)(1) No person shall dispose of any vehicle tire within the state except by delivery of the tire to a facility operated by the Rhode Island resource recovery corporation designated for that purpose, or to a privately operated tire storage or tire recycling or recovery facility licensed by the director of environmental management for that purpose or by delivery for transportation to an out-of-state recycling facility.
